Find the area of a rectangle 3yds by 4/7yds

\text{We're trying to find the area of the rectangle}\\\\\text{We know the dimensions are 3 by 4/7}\\\\\text{The formula to find the area of a rectangle is length x width}\\\\\text{Solve for area:}\\\\3\cdot\frac{4}{7}\\\\\text{Multiply the 3 to the numerator}\\\\\frac{12}{7}\\\\\text{Since we can't simply it, we'll leave it as is}\\\\\boxed{\text{Answer:} \frac{12}{7}\,\,yd^2}

A Sum of $14 is made of 92 coins consisting of dimes and quarters. How Many are there of each kind of coin
steposvetlana [31]
So first I would say, what if all of them were dimes, how far away would it be from $14?

So 92 coins * 10 cents = $9.20

So it's 4.80 dollars away from 14 dollars.

So if we were to switch one to a quarter, it would increase by 0.15 cents.

So we want to see how many increases we need to reach 4.80 dollars more.

4.80/0.15 = 32

So there are 32 quarters and 60 dimes.
